近年来,己二酸市场成长显着,预计将以5.6%的复合年增长率成长,从2025年的74.6亿美元成长到2026年的78.8亿美元。过去几年的成长归因于尼龙纤维产量增加、汽车製造业扩张、增塑剂需求上升、聚氨酯泡棉中应用增加以及石化原料供应稳定等因素。

预计未来几年己二酸市场将稳定成长,到2030年市场规模将达到95.7亿美元,复合年增长率(CAGR)为5.0%。预测期内的主要成长要素包括:对轻型电动车的需求、向永续聚合物的转型、建筑隔热材料市场的成长、己二酸合成技术的进步以及在包装领域应用的日益广泛。预测期内的主要趋势包括:汽车应用领域对尼龙6,6的需求不断增长、己二酸在轻质工程塑料中的应用不断扩大、生物基己二酸生产路线的日益普及、建筑行业对聚氨酯的需求不断增长,以及对工艺效率和排放的日益重视。

汽车产业的成长预计将推动己二酸市场的扩张。汽车产业指的是参与汽车设计、开发、製造、行销和销售的公司和活动。其成长的驱动力来自个人出行需求的不断增长、经济的扩张以及持续的都市化。己二酸显着提升汽车零件和材料的性能、耐久性和美观性,从而提高车辆的效率和安全性。例如,根据英国汽车製造商和贸易商英国(SMMT) 2024 年 4 月发布的报告,到 2023 年,英国道路上的车辆数量将达到 4,140 万辆,其中乘用车保有量将增加 1.6%,达到 3,570 万辆。因此,可以说汽车产业的扩张正在推动己二酸市场的成长。

己二酸市场的主要企业正致力于开发创新产品,例如生物基尼龙6,6,以提高永续性并减少聚合物生产的碳足迹。生物基尼龙6,6是一种聚酰胺基聚合物,它使用可再生原料(例如废弃食用油和植物来源材料)而非传统的石化燃料生产。例如,2024年12月,总部位于美国的工程塑胶和高性能化学品製造商Ascend Performance Materials成功地利用废弃食用油衍生的原料生产了丙烯腈、己二胺、己二酸和尼龙6,6,用于其BioServe产品线。与传统尼龙相比,这种尼龙6,6的碳足迹降低了25%,同时保持了相同的机械强度、热稳定性和加工灵活性。这种生物基尼龙6,6适用于纺织品、汽车零件和工业应用等高性能领域,提供了永续的替代方案,且不会影响品质或性能。

Adipic acid is a white, crystalline dicarboxylic acid with the molecular formula C6H10O4. Its primary applications include the production of nylon and the manufacturing of plasticizers, polyurethane, lubricants, and food additives.

The main raw materials for adipic acid production are cyclohexanol and cyclohexanone. Cyclohexanol is crucial as it undergoes oxidation to form adipic acid, a pivotal step in the manufacturing process. Sales channels for adipic acid include both direct and indirect sales. Its applications span nylon 6, 6 fiber, nylon 6, 6 resin, polyurethanes, and adipate esters, serving various industries such as automotive, electrical and electronics, packaging, consumer products, building and construction, textiles, and others.

Tariffs have significantly influenced the adipic acid market by increasing costs associated with imported raw materials such as cyclohexanone and cyclohexanol, thereby affecting overall production economics. Higher duties have particularly impacted nylon 6,6 fiber and resin segments in Asia Pacific and Europe, where cross border chemical trade is extensive. These tariffs have led manufacturers to re evaluate sourcing strategies and absorb cost pressures across automotive and textile applications. On the positive side, tariffs have encouraged local production investments and capacity expansions in emerging markets, strengthening regional supply chains and reducing long term import dependence.

The adipic acid market size has grown strongly in recent years. It will grow from $7.46 billion in 2025 to $7.88 billion in 2026 at a compound annual growth rate (CAGR) of 5.6%. The growth in the historic period can be attributed to growth of nylon fiber production, expansion of automotive manufacturing, rising demand for plasticizers, increased use in polyurethane foams, availability of petrochemical feedstocks.

The adipic acid market size is expected to see steady growth in the next few years. It will grow to $9.57 billion in 2030 at a compound annual growth rate (CAGR) of 5.0%. The growth in the forecast period can be attributed to electric vehicle lightweighting demand, shift toward sustainable polymers, growth in construction insulation materials, technological advancements in adipic acid synthesis, rising packaging applications. Major trends in the forecast period include increasing demand for nylon 6,6 in automotive applications, rising use of adipic acid in lightweight engineering plastics, growing adoption of bio based adipic acid production routes, expansion of polyurethane applications in construction, higher focus on process efficiency and emission reduction.

The increasing automobile industry is expected to propel the growth of the adipic acid market going forward. The automobile industry encompasses the companies and activities involved in designing, developing, manufacturing, marketing, and selling motor vehicles. Its growth is driven by rising demand for personal mobility, economic expansion, and ongoing urbanization. Adipic acid contributes significantly to the performance, durability, and aesthetics of automotive components and materials, enhancing vehicle efficiency and safety. For example, in April 2024, the Society of Motor Manufacturers and Traders, a UK-based trade association, reported that the number of vehicles on UK roads reached 41.4 million in 2023, with car ownership rising by 1.6% to 35.7 million. Therefore, the expansion of the automobile industry is driving the growth of the adipic acid market.

Major companies in the adipic acid market are focusing on developing innovative products, such as bio-based nylon 6,6, to improve sustainability and reduce the carbon footprint associated with polymer production. Bio-based nylon 6,6 is a polyamide polymer produced using renewable feedstocks such as used cooking oil or plant-derived materials instead of traditional fossil fuels. For instance, in December 2024, Ascend Performance Materials, a U.S.-based manufacturer of engineered plastics and performance chemicals, successfully produced acrylonitrile, hexamethylene diamine, adipic acid, and nylon 6,6 from used cooking-oil-derived feedstocks under its Bioserve portfolio. The resulting nylon 6,6 has a 25% lower carbon footprint compared with conventional nylon while maintaining equivalent mechanical strength, thermal stability, and processing versatility. This bio-based nylon 6,6 is suitable for high-performance applications in textiles, automotive components, and industrial uses, offering a sustainable alternative without compromising quality or performance.

In July 2025, BASF SE, a Germany-based chemical company, acquired a 49% stake from DOMO Chemicals in their joint venture Alsachimie for an undisclosed amount. This acquisition aims to strengthen BASF's polyamide 6.6 production capabilities and enhance supply chain integration of key raw materials. DOMO Chemicals GmbH is a Germany-based company specializing in the production of polyamide 6.6 precursors, including KA-oil, adipic acid, and hexamethylenediamine adipate, serving automotive, consumer goods, industrial, and electrical and electronics sectors.
